Cyrtosperma macrotum
Cyrtosperma macrotum is a tropical aroid species native to Southeast Asia. The plant is distinguished by its tall, upright inflorescence composed of a cylindrical spadix covered with tiny flowers, partially enclosed by a large reddish to brown spathe. This feature is typical of the genus Cyrtosperma, which includes several species adapted to aquatic or semi-aquatic conditions. Photographed in Florida.
